1. Mastering Chain Selection and Sharpening for Peak Performance
The chain is the heart of your Stihl 044’s cutting ability. A dull chain not only slows you down but also puts unnecessary strain on the saw’s engine, reducing its lifespan and increasing fuel consumption. I’ve seen firsthand how proper chain selection and sharpening can transform a struggling saw into a wood-eating monster.
- Chain Type Matters: Don’t just grab any chain off the shelf. Match the chain to the type of wood you’re cutting. For hardwoods like oak and maple, a chisel chain with a square-cornered cutter is ideal for aggressive cutting. For softer woods like pine, a semi-chisel chain with rounded corners will be more forgiving and less prone to dulling quickly.
- Sharpening is Key: I cannot stress this enough: a sharp chain is a safe chain. A dull chain requires more force, increasing the risk of kickback. Learn to sharpen your chain correctly, either by hand with a file or with a chain grinder. Invest in a good-quality file guide to maintain the correct angles.
- Sharpening Frequency: As a general rule, sharpen your chain every time you refuel. This might seem excessive, but it ensures consistent performance and prevents the chain from becoming excessively dull. I personally use the “three-file-strokes-per-tooth” method after every tank of gas.
- Depth Gauge Adjustment: The depth gauge controls how much wood each cutter takes with each pass. If the depth gauges are too high, the chain will cut slowly. If they’re too low, the chain will grab and vibrate excessively. Use a depth gauge tool to maintain the correct height, usually around .025 inches for most chains.
- Chain Tension: Proper chain tension is crucial for smooth cutting and preventing chain damage. A properly tensioned chain should be snug against the bar but still able to be pulled around the bar by hand. Too loose, and the chain will derail. Too tight, and it will bind and overheat.

2. Optimizing Bar Length and Maintenance for Maximum Power Transfer
The bar length of your Stihl 044 directly impacts its cutting capacity and maneuverability. Choosing the right bar and maintaining it properly is essential for maximizing power transfer and preventing premature wear.
- Matching Bar Length to the Task: A longer bar allows you to fell larger trees, but it also requires more power and can be more difficult to control. A shorter bar is more maneuverable and ideal for smaller tasks like limbing and firewood preparation. I generally recommend a 20-inch bar for all-around use with a Stihl 044, but adjust based on the size of the trees you typically encounter.
- Bar Maintenance is Non-Negotiable: Regularly clean the bar groove to remove sawdust and debris. This ensures proper chain lubrication and prevents premature wear. Use a bar rail dressing tool to keep the bar rails square and prevent the chain from wobbling.
- Bar Oiling: Ensure your Stihl 044 is properly oiling the bar and chain. Check the oiler output regularly and adjust it as needed. A dry chain will quickly overheat and dull, leading to poor cutting performance and potential damage to the saw. I prefer using a high-quality bar and chain oil specifically designed for chainsaws.
- Bar Rotation: Rotate your bar regularly to distribute wear evenly. This will extend its lifespan and prevent it from bending or warping.
- Bar Inspection: Inspect your bar regularly for signs of wear, such as burrs, cracks, or uneven rails. A damaged bar can be dangerous and should be replaced immediately.

3. Fuel and Air Management: Unleashing the Engine’s Potential
The Stihl 044 is a powerful machine, but it needs the right fuel and air mixture to perform at its best. Proper fuel and air management is crucial for maximizing horsepower and ensuring the engine runs smoothly.
- Fuel Quality: Always use high-quality gasoline with the correct octane rating (typically 89 octane). Avoid using old or stale fuel, as it can damage the engine. I always add a fuel stabilizer to my gasoline to prevent it from degrading, especially during periods of inactivity.
- Fuel Mix: Use the correct fuel-to-oil ratio for your Stihl 044, as specified in the owner’s manual (typically 50:1). Use a high-quality two-stroke oil specifically designed for chainsaws. Mixing the fuel and oil properly is essential for lubricating the engine and preventing damage.
- Air Filter Maintenance: A clean air filter is crucial for proper engine performance. Regularly clean or replace the air filter to ensure adequate airflow. A clogged air filter will restrict airflow, causing the engine to run lean and overheat. I clean my air filter after every day of use, or more frequently if I’m working in dusty conditions.
- Spark Plug Inspection: Inspect the spark plug regularly for signs of wear or fouling. A fouled spark plug can cause the engine to misfire and lose power. Replace the spark plug as needed.
- Carburetor Adjustment: The carburetor controls the fuel-to-air mixture. If your Stihl 044 is not running smoothly, it may be necessary to adjust the carburetor. This is best left to a qualified mechanic, but understanding the basics of carburetor adjustment can be helpful.

4. Mastering Cutting Techniques for Efficiency and Safety
Even with a perfectly tuned Stihl 044, poor cutting techniques can lead to wasted time, increased risk of injury, and subpar results. Mastering proper cutting techniques is essential for both efficiency and safety.
- Felling Techniques: Before felling a tree, assess the lean, wind direction, and surrounding obstacles. Use proper felling techniques, such as the Humboldt or open-face notch, to control the direction of the fall. Always have a clear escape route planned.
- Limbing Techniques: Limb trees from the bottom up, using the chainsaw to cut branches close to the trunk. Avoid cutting branches from above, as they can fall unexpectedly and cause injury.
- Bucking Techniques: Bucking is the process of cutting felled trees into smaller logs. Use proper bucking techniques to avoid pinching the saw and ensure clean, efficient cuts. Support the log properly to prevent it from rolling or shifting during cutting.
- Avoiding Pinching: Pinching occurs when the saw blade becomes trapped in the wood. Use wedges or levers to prevent the wood from closing in on the blade. If the saw does become pinched, shut it off immediately and use a wedge to free the blade.
- Body Positioning: Maintain a stable stance and keep your body weight balanced. Avoid overreaching or twisting your body, as this can increase the risk of injury.

5. Project Planning and Workflow Optimization for Maximum Output
Efficient woodcutting isn’t just about the saw; it’s about the entire process, from planning the harvest to preparing the firewood. Optimizing your workflow can significantly increase your output and reduce wasted time and effort.
- Harvest Planning: Before starting any woodcutting project, develop a detailed harvest plan. This should include identifying the trees to be felled, planning the felling direction, and outlining the bucking and splitting process. Consider factors such as tree size, species, and accessibility.
- Log Handling Efficiency: Optimize your log handling process to minimize wasted time and effort. Use skidding tongs, log loaders, or other equipment to move logs efficiently. Stack logs in a way that allows for easy access and efficient splitting.
- Splitting Optimization: Choose the right splitting method for the type of wood you’re working with. For straight-grained wood, a splitting maul or hydraulic splitter is ideal. For knotty or twisted wood, a wedge and sledgehammer may be necessary.
- Drying Strategies: Properly drying firewood is crucial for maximizing its heating value. Stack firewood in a well-ventilated area and allow it to dry for at least six months, or preferably longer. Use a moisture meter to check the moisture content of the wood before burning it. Aim for a moisture content of 20% or less.
- Sustainable Harvesting: Practice sustainable harvesting techniques to ensure the long-term health of the forest. Avoid clear-cutting large areas and focus on selective harvesting. Leave standing dead trees for wildlife habitat. Replant trees as needed to maintain forest cover.
